The benefits of physical activity are due to several factors. In particular, physical activity has favorable direct actions on the cardiovascular system and reduces high blood pressure.

The connection between physical activity, disease risk and death is so strong that the World Health Organization launched, in 2013, the global plan for physical activity called “ More active people for a healthier world ” ( i.e. “more active people for a healthier world”), which aims to reduce the number of inactive people by 15% by 2030.
After having a heart problem, it is normal to be afraid of making an effort and doing physical activity or sports . However, you don’t have to let the fear of having another cardiac event take over!
So yes, you can and should resume physical activity after having a heart problem.
Even if you can start moving again, you still need to be careful not to overdo it or make too intense movements .
What do you have to do? Take your time, don’t rush and don’t set unrealistic goals . Keep in mind that each person recovers at different times and in different ways . The recovery time depends on the level of physical activity you were doing before the cardiac event and the extent of damage to your heart. Aerobic activity must be alternated with anaerobic, or resistance , activity , to be performed at least twice a week to improve muscle mass and strength (e.g. weight lifting, fast running, heavy athletics). For each muscle group, eight to twelve repetitions of exercises are recommended , with a recovery of about two minutes between sets , using a weight such that the final repetition can be performed correctly, but a further repetition is impossible.
